Create a website of at least 3 separate (but linked) pages that is an information or promotional resource about an imaginary country -- e.g you should include a map, information about the country -- principal industries, its inhabitants, its geography, history, tourist and recreation possibilities, animal and plant life, etc. Source or create appropriate graphics. This includes titles, information graphics such as maps and graphs as well as illustration. Your website should include appropriate headings, graphics and links and may be as many pages as appropriate. Code must be valid and all files should be correctly named (no spaces or punctuation in file names, and correctly suffixed). It should be structured to reflect general guidelines for good web writing. Important Note: You must invent this country -- do0 not use aan existing imaginaary location (unless you completely re-vamp the concept).
